Output e03c63a2a4c3895990f427b1d0ec8cc3a12f017767d9e4592aabbf58cd316726:1

value
53857
script pubkey
OP_0 OP_PUSHBYTES_20 e6ac49ae8aa9a72571c0fb6e7fbdf754a52f988b
address
bc1qu6kynt524xnj2uwqldh8l00h2jjjlxytc00d5x
transaction
e03c63a2a4c3895990f427b1d0ec8cc3a12f017767d9e4592aabbf58cd316726
confirmations
254971
spent
true